SENIOR CHIEF OF FACILITIES

SUMMARY:

The Senior Chief of Facilities directs and coordinates activities of the Facilities department.

R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Establishes priorities by reviewing and assigning work related tasks.
  • Schedules repairs, maintenance while ensuring continuous production operations.
  • Interfaces with other department heads on work priorities and activities.
  • Develops and implements preventative maintenance and engineering programs.
  • Plans, develops, and implements procedures to improve operations.
  • Review production, quality control, facilities reports, and statistics to plan and modify activities.
  • Prepares department budget and monitors expenditures.
  • Reports to management on activities of department.
  • Interacts with general/sub-contractors overseeing projects from inception to completion.
  • Complies with all regulatory agency requirements to maintain required permits and/or licenses.
  • Resolve employee grievances.
  • Requisition tools, equipment, and supplies.
  • May perform duties of subordinate team members, as needed, but limited to, no more than thirty percent (30%) physical involvement.
  • Completes all required Company trainings and compliance courses as assigned.
  • Adheres to Company standards and maintains compliance with all policies and procedures.
  • Performs other related duties as assigned.

QUALIFICATIONS:

  • Technical/Trade school certification related to facilities, maintenance or related field.
  • A minimum of four (4) years of experience in facilities, maintenance, or related field.
  • A minimum of four (4) years of supervisory experience.
  • OSHA 30.
  • Certified Pool Operator (CPO) Certification.
  • Universal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) Certification.
  • Driver’s License (non-commercial) – must be state specific.
